5. Pericardium(ANSWER) membranous fibrous sac enclosing the heart and the bases of the great vessels
6. Where is the carotid pulse(ANSWER) between the trachea and sternocleidomastoid muscle
7. Where is the brachial pulse(ANSWER) palpated at the antecubital fossa, medial side of the arm
8. What is the normal time for capillary refill?(ANSWER) Less than 3 seconds
9. How do you test capillary refill?(ANSWER) press down on the nail bed until the nail blanches (turns white),
Release the nail and note the time for color to return
10. What position should a patient be in for a cardiac assessment?(ANSWER) Supine with HOB at 30 degrees

23. Peripheral artery disease (PAD)(ANSWER) narrowing/occlusion by atherosclerotic plaques of arteries outside of the heart and brain
24. Cause of PAD(ANSWER) build up of fatty deposits and atherosclerotic vascular changes to endothelial lining of blood vessels
25. Cultural considerations with PAD(ANSWER) diabetes and high blood pressure are more common among African Americans,
creating a higher risk for PAD
26. Hypertension(ANSWER) BP greater than or equal to 140/90
27. Peripheral vascular disease(ANSWER) any condition that causes partial or complete obstruction of the flow of
Blood to or from the arteries or veins outside the chest
28. Signs and symptoms of peripheral vascular disease(ANSWER) pain, pallor, coolness to touch, asymmetry
29. Risk factors for peripheral vascular disease(ANSWER) family history of PAD/heart disease/stroke, age, smoking, diabetes,
obesity, hypertension and high cholesterol
30. Health promotion for peripheral vascular disease(ANSWER) inspect feet daily for signs and symp- toms of
wounds/ulcers
31. Varicose veins(ANSWER) swollen/bulging veins, exercise should be stopped if there is any pain or discomfort
32. Cardiac testing procedures(ANSWER) holter monitor, echocardiogram, exercise stress test, electrocardiogram
33. Holter monitor(ANSWER) 24 hour test recording cardiac electrical activity
34. Echocardiogram(ANSWER) noninvasive ultrasound using high-frequency sound waves of various intensities to help
Diagnose cardiovascular disorders
35. What cardiac abnormality are echocardiograms used to establish(ANSWER) cause of a heart murmur
36. Exercise stress test(ANSWER) monitors heart function and rhythm while the patient walks/runs on a treadmill under physical stress
37. Exercise stress test tests for(ANSWER) heart rate, heart rhythms, breathing, BP, EKG, exercise fatigue. May help identify cause of chest
pain/SOB
38. Electrocardiogram (ECG/EKG)(ANSWER) provides vital information about the heart's electrical conduction system; records the
electrical activity of the heart; helps diagnose abnormal heartbeats, heart rhythm, and tissue ischemia
39. Heart healthy diet(ANSWER) fruits, veggies, whole grains, low cholesterol, low trans fat, low sodium
